Cook bacon in the oven. Cover cookie sheet with tinfoil first. Do 375 for about 20 min instead of 400 for ten because the lower and slower the more fat renders out. Then all the bacon is done at the same time, meanwhile you were free to make the rest of breakfast. This is how we always cook our bacon. Lots less mess!
